Built to last: halogen tech and the R7s connector
We lean on halogen-filled infrared lamps because they’re tough—built for the daily grind. The halogen cycle helps keep the quartz envelope clear, so you don’t get blackening and the output stays steady over time. The quartz glass also handles quick temperature shifts, so the on/off cycle of daily use won’t crack it. Then there’s the R7s connector. It gives you a secure, two-point connection that can handle the current draw reliably. It’s a drop-in fit for many mirror housings, which means faster installs and fewer worries about loose connections.
How it feels in your bathroom
With this setup, you get localized radiant heat. It warms surfaces and objects directly, instead of trying to heat the whole room. So your mirror stays clear—no fog—and you feel warmth right where you need it. The air doesn’t get overheated, and the room stays comfortable.
Safety, heat, and practical details
The CE certification means the unit meets recognized safety standards for electrical and thermal performance. That’s reassuring. Just keep one thing in mind: the lamp runs hot. Make sure there’s enough clearance and ventilation inside the mirror housing. That keeps everything cool enough to run smoothly, reliably, for the long haul.
